Crypto’s Anti-Surveillance Boom: Zcash, Monero and the Return of Anonymity
3 months ago
8805
Privacy coins are outperforming as traders turn away from ETFs and transparent ledgers, reviving crypto’s oldest idea: digital cash that can move freely, without surveillance.
